摘 要:目的CT测量中国高原地区藏族健康成年人股骨后髁角,比较藏族和汉族成年人股骨后髁角(posterior condylar angle,PCA)的差异并总结其临床意义。方法纳入2020年1月至2020年10月西藏自治区人民政府驻成都办事处医院体检健康的藏族成年志愿者55例110膝,男30例(60膝),女25例(50膝);年龄25~48岁;平均年龄(32.19±11.15)岁;应用64排螺旋CT进行0.75mm扫描及三维重建,将获得的影像资料导入Auto Cad 2012及Camera Measure 2.1.3.250软件进行测量,获得评估股骨髁旋转角度的数据,分组后与其他文献比较,分析藏汉民族包括股骨后髁角在内的股骨远端旋转角度的差异。结果藏族成人PCA平均(3.16±0.55)°;男性平均(3.32±0.54)°,女性平均(2.97±0.50)°;左膝平均(3.17±0.60)°,右膝平均(3.15±0.53)°。髁扭转角(condylar torsion angle,CTA)平均(6.26±0.77)°;男性平均(6.28±0.80)°,女性平均(6.25±0.75)°;左膝平均(6.28±0.78)°,右膝平均(6.25±0.78)°。PCA、CTA在性别和左右两侧的比较,差异无统计学意义。临床上髁轴线与外科上髁轴线夹角(condylar shaft angle,CSA)平均(3.10±0.41)°;男性平均(2.95±0.40)°,女性平均(3.27±0.37)°;左膝平均(3.27±0.37)°,右膝平均(3.10±0.44)°。CSA在性别上比较,女性大于男性,差异有统计学意义。结论高原地区藏族成人PCA与国内文献报道中汉族成人角度近似,符合汉藏同源的观点。藏族PCA有性别差异,高原藏族成年男性全膝关节置换中仍适用股骨远端截骨外旋3°的标准,女性是否适合这个标准有待验证。Objective To measure the posterior condylar angle(PCA)of the femur in healthy adults from Tibetan Plateau of China wihCTscans,compared the results with those of Chinese Han and explorethe clinical significance of the results.Methods From January 2020 to October 2020,55 healthy adult volunteers from Tibetan Plateau of China who had healthy physical examinations at the Hospital of Chengdu Office of People's Government of Tibetan Autonomous Region were enrolled.There were 30 males(60 knees)and 25 females(50 knees)with an average age of(32.19±11.15)years old(range,25~48).All patients had 64-slice CT scans of the knees done with a slice thickness of 0.75 mm and three-dimensional reconstruction was conducted.The images were distinguished in Auto Cad 2012 and Camera Measure 2.1.3.250 software to measure the rotation angles of femoral condyle including PCA.The measurement results were compared with the data of Chinese Han in literature and subgroup analysis was performed.Results The average PCA of Tibetan adults was(3.16±0.55)°,mean of(3.32±0.54)°for males versus(2.97±0.50)°for females,and mean of(3.17±0.60)°for left knees versus(3.15±0.53)°for right knees.The average condylar torsion angle(CTA)of Tibetan adults was(6.26±0.77)°,mean of(6.28±0.80)°for males versus(6.25±0.75)°for females,and mean of(6.28±0.78)°for left knees versus(3.15±0.53)°for right knees.The difference of gender and sides on both PCA and TCA were not statistically significant.The condylar shaft angle(CSA)which was formed by the intersection of clinical epicondylar axis and the surgical epicondylar axis was(3.10±0.41)°in average,mean of(2.95±0.40)°in males versus(3.27±0.37)°for females and mean of(3.27±0.37)°for left knees versus(3.10±0.44)°for right knee.The average CSA in females was larger than that of the males and the difference was statistically significant.Conclusion The PCA of adults from Tibetan Plateau of China is similar to that of Chinese Han adults reported in domestic literature,which supports the view that C
